어리바리 신입 개발자의 얼렁뚱땅 개발 기록 ✨
23.02.28 / 개발 환경 구성하기 본문
728x90
[ web server & WAS(Web Application Server / 와스) : apache-tomcat ]
- 설치 버전 or 특정 폴더에 위치 시키는 버전 중 후자 선택해서 작업 진행 예정
- http://tomcat.apache.org/ - Apache-tomcat9.072 버전 다운로드
- 압축 풀고 작업 환경을 구성할 폴더(작업 공간 폴더)와 같은 폴더에 위치 시킨다.
[ server side language / 서버 측 언어 / Back end : java ]
- jdk & jre 설치 (18버전)
- jdk-8u144-windows-x64 파일 설치 (설치 경로 c드라이브 그대로)
[ DBMS / 자료 저장소 : oracle ]
- http://oracle.com/ - 나중에 메뉴얼 보면서 가입하기 설치 예정
- https://www.oracle.com/java/technologies/downloads
[ editor / 편집도구 : eclipse ]
- http://eclipse.org/ - eclipse-jee-2022-03-R-win32-x86_64.zip 다운로드
- 압축 풀고 eclipse 폴더에서 eclipse.exe 파일으로 실행하기
[ eclipse 실행하기 ]
- work space(작업 공간) 폴더 생성
- eclipse.exe 실행
- work space(작업공간) 폴더 선택 ▼
[ eclipse 프로젝트 생성 & apache - tomcat 연결하기 ]
- 프로젝트 생성 : 왼쪽 Project Explorer 창에서 오른쪽 마우스 - new - Dynamic Web Project - project name 입력
- Apache Tomcat 연결 하기 : Target runtime 탭에서 New Runtime 누르기
- Apache 폴더의 Apache Tomcat v9.0 선택 후 Next
- Browse... - 개발 환경 구성하면서 설치해서 위치시켰던 apache tomcat 폴더 선택 후 Finish
- Next
- Context root = 처음에 설정했던 Project name
- content directory : client side language가 위치하는 곳 (html / css/ java script / JQuery 등)
- Finish
[ eclipse .jsp 파일 만들고 서버 연결하기]
- 왼쪽 Project Explorer 창에서
- ex(Project name) - src -main - webapp 오른쪽 마우스 - new - JSP file (java server page)
- File name 설정하고 Finish (확장자명 .jsp 꼭 붙어있어야 한다.)
- Manually define a new server 선택
- Tomcat v9.0 Server 선택 후 Finish
- 브라우저에서 확인하기
- 브라우저에서 http://localhost:8080/ex/a.jsp 로 확인할 수 있다.
- ( localhost에 웹서비스를 제공하는 웹 서버의 아이피 주소 입력)
- 아이피 주소 확인하기 : 시작 - cmd - ipconfig - ipv4가 아이피 주소
- 호스트의 컴퓨터는 웹서버이다. 웹서버로부터 웹서비스를 제공 받는 것.
[ eclipse 실행 브라우저 변경]
- window - web browser - chrome
[ eclipse 패키지 만들기 & 클래스 만들기]
- 패키지 만들기 : 왼쪽 Project Explorer 창에서 src/main/java - 오른쪽 마우스 - new - package
- Name : 패키지 이름
- 패키지가 생성된 모습
- 패키지의 이름에 맞게 작업 공간 폴더에 패키지 폴더들이 만들어진다.
- 클래스 만들기 : 왼쪽 Project Explorer 창에서 앞서 만든 패키지 오른쪽 마우스 - new - class
- 클래스의 이름에서 가장 첫 단어는 대문자를 사용한다.
- 클래스의 이름에서 연결 되는 단어일 경우 단어의 가장 첫 단어는 대문자를 사용한다. (UserInfor)
- public static void main(String[] args)를 선택하면 자동으로 public ~ 코드가 입력된 클래스가 만들어진다.
- 클래스가 만들어진 모습
- 작업 공간 폴더에도 클래스 파일이 저장된다.
[ eclipse 클래스 파일 저장하고 콘솔창에서 출력 확인하기]
- Ctrl + S -> Ctrl + F11
[ eclipse export & import]
- 왼쪽 Project Explorer 창에서 export 혹은 import 할 Project name 오른쪽 마우스 - import 또는 export - WAR file
- War file 찾아서 import
- web project에 export 할 이름 적고 Destination에서 export 할 위치 찾기
- Export source files 체크하고 export 해야한다.
728x90
'Back - end > JAVA' 카테고리의 다른 글
23.02.28 / 메서드 선언과 호출의 원리 (0) | 2023.03.08 |
---|---|
eclipse 단축키 (0) | 2023.03.08 |
23.03.03 / 표기법 (0) | 2023.03.03 |
23.03.03 / 개발 환경 셋팅 / JDK JRE JVM (0) | 2023.03.03 |
23.02.27 / 개발 환경과 종류 (0) | 2023.02.27 |